from sos.report.plugins import Plugin, IndependentPlugin
class Xfs(Plugin, IndependentPlugin): """This plugin collects information on mounted XFS filessystems on the local system.
Users should expect `xfs_info` and `xfs_admin` collections by this plugin for each XFS filesystem that is locally mounted. """
short_desc = 'XFS filesystem'
plugin_name = 'xfs' profiles = ('storage',) files = ('/sys/fs/xfs', '/proc/fs/xfs') kernel_mods = ('xfs',)
def setup(self): mounts = '/proc/mounts' ext_fs_regex = r"^(/dev/.+).+xfs\s+" for dev in zip(self.do_regex_find_all(ext_fs_regex, mounts)): for ext in dev: parts = ext.split(' ') self.add_cmd_output("xfs_info %s" % (parts[1]), tags="xfs_info") self.add_cmd_output("xfs_admin -l -u %s" % (parts[0]))
self.add_copy_spec([ '/proc/fs/xfs', '/sys/fs/xfs' ])
